What precaution is necessary when installing ultrahigh efficiency filters?

Explanation:
The key idea is that the edges of ultrahigh efficiency filters must be sealed to prevent air from bypassing the filter media. When there are gaps around the perimeter, some of the airstream can flow through these gaps rather than through the filter material, dramatically reducing the overall effectiveness of the filtration. A proper seal around the edges ensures the entire airflow passes through the filter, preserving the rated efficiency and preventing unfiltered air from reaching occupied spaces. The other considerations—orientation, bypassing primary air, or grounding—are not the essential precaution for achieving the filter’s performance; sealing around the edges is the critical step.
